    At some point, it just becomes the market value, rather then overpriced, if that's the going price (and Batum is much better than Green) for free agents.

    It's like saying "I consider anything over $2500 overpriced for a new car." You're welcome to set your own standards for value, but that doesn't mean $30,000 is actually overpriced for a new car.

    IMO, what is affecting perception of what constitutes "overpaid" are the two classes of contract that are purposefully artificially suppressed: rookie deals and max deals. Especially max deals. In a purely free market, there's no doubt that top-tier superstars and even solid stars would make significantly more than the max. But those players get capped. While fans then think that every other player salary should scale from there (if a player is a fifth the value of a superstar, he should make a fifth of the max, etc), that's not the way it works. Everyone outside those two classes of contract is subject to something like a free market...so their contracts are going to look strange compared to max level players. Not because they're overpaid, IMO, but because max level players are (by and large) underpaid. I'm not saying max-level players deserve sympathy (or any player, really) since this is all subject to CBA negotiation...but I think fan idea of what constitutes overpaid is out of step with what a lot of these players will actually end up getting paid due to the presence of max deals. If LeBron James and Dwight Howard were making closer to, say, $50 million per year (and the salary cap likewise were set at the level necessary for those kinds of player salaries, Batum at $11 million wouldn't look overpaid.
